    On Friday, the "Park" light began to glow ever so slightly while the car was running, and as the day wore on (at the track) the light got brighter and brighter - until it now fully on all the time. When I pull the handbrake up and down, there is a slight change in the intensity, so I think the switch is working fine. I suspect it is another one of those fusebox gremlins.

    I can't wait to get it replaced.

    If anyone thinks it is some other problem let me know. I am sure the handbrake is not set, but I have not pulled the trim off the car to be able to look at the switch.
